Surprisingly, Tamdhu was mothballed in 2010 but new owner Ian MacLeod stepped in and completely turned the distillery around. They refurbished the distillery and opened a visitors’ center on site. Their investment is really starting to pay off. In recent years Tamdhu has become somewhat of a go-to single malt for whisky drinkers that enjoy a proper sherry-matured dram. The Tamdhu 12 Y is a great example. It matured exclusively in a combination of first-fill and refill Oloroso sherry casks.
